Speaking this week at the Bloomberg New Energy Finance conference in New York, Total SA’s chief energy economist, Joel Couse, forecasted that EVs will make up 15 to 30 percent of global new vehicle sales by 2030. One barrier is the cost of owning an electric vehicle versus a cheaper, comparable gasoline-engine vehicle.

A new study by a team from San Jose State University and Stanford University has found that—even under heightened damage estimates—the additional mitigation costs of limiting global warming to 1.5 °C C by 2100 would eventually confer net benefits of thousands of trillions of dollars in gross world product by 2300.

Global energy demand will increase 25% between 2014 and 2040, driven by population growth and economic expansion, ExxonMobil forecasts in the 2016 edition of its annual The Outlook for Energy. The company forecasts modest gains for plug-in electric cars, with cost and functionality remaining barriers. Source: ExxonMobil.
